What's cynical about putting an iPhone in a bikini top? or running a swimsuit edition of Geekzone?

by Guy J Kewney | posted on 07 July 2007


Call me cynical, but my eyes did close in a tired sigh when I got my AOL email this morning. "What's Hot!" it said, and went on to encourage me to get a swimsuit by referring me to the AOL search page:

Summer equals bathing suits. Instead of shopping for disappointment, find bathing suits that fit you on AOL Search. Search less and discover more.

Look, how old do you have to be to realise that entering "bathing suits" into a search engine will get you lots of "acceptable" images of young women, not over-dressed? And that's all AOL was giving me: a search engine window with a search term already loaded. As if anybody would buy swimming costumes when it's already summer! - go to any shop, and you'll find they're showcasing their winter sports gear already.

So, let's be cynical, I thought. Let's enter "+swimsuit +iphone" as our search term.

Sure enough: "Bikini Swimsuit Featuring Integrated iPod Controls" says iPodhacks. "With this latest example of technology integration from Korea, jumping to the next track is as simple as touching your upper chest."

Ahem. Moving on, how many hits would you expect our search term to throw up? "Results 1 - 10 of about 472,000 for +iphone +swimsuit" says Google.

OK, so some of those are just web sites which have "swimsuit" in one story, and "iPhone in another, as does Luxlist [see gold swimsuit, right] with its $80,000 gold swimsuit. The iPhone story is a completely different one (an anti-scratch condom for the screen). But what the heck (says the cynic) if we can run a photo of a scantily clad lass?

For what it's worth, your dedicated swimsuit reporter abandoned the search at the point where "Miss Hooters" (no, really!) turned out to be a story which Geekzone was prepared to run. Excuse?

"This post has absolutely nothing to do with technology. Or perhaps it has a lot, after all we are all geeks, right?"

I know when I'm being out-cynicked. So I searched for "+bikini +iphone" and at that point, I realised I was being out-geeked, too: Incipio has come up with a leather case for the phone. And Incipio cleverly calls it a bikini [right] and someone has posted this picture of the phone wearing "her" new garment.

In the interests of modesty, we've pixellated out that bit at the bottom, just in case...
